Neshoba County schools: Which ethnicity was most represented in 2023-24 school year?

Among the ethnicities represented in Neshoba County schools, white was the most prevalent among the county students in the 2023-24 school year, according to the Mississippi Department of Education.

Of the 3,858 students attending Neshoba County schools, 50.9% were white. Black students were the second most common ethnicity, making up 31.9% of Neshoba County student body.

In the previous school year, white students were also the most common group in Neshoba County, representing 50.2% of the student body.

In the 2023-24 school year, the total number of students enrolled in public schools in the county dropped 0.2% when compared to the previous year.

Mississippi’s schools, with an enrollment of 436,523 in the 2023-24 academic year, are mostly divided between two ethnicities, with Black or African American students being the largest racial group at 46.86%, followed by white students at 42.14%.

Students in the state showed a significant improvement in the 2022-23 academic year, demonstrating sustained progress in their post-pandemic recovery. Overall, 87% of schools and 91% of districts achieved a grade of C or better, compared to 81% of schools and 87% of districts in the prior year.

Results from the 2022-23 Mississippi Academic Assessment Program (MAAP) showed students reaching an all-time high in all core subjects. Students better performed on the Math and English portion of the test, achieving grades around 5% better than in the previous year.

Neshoba County Students’ Most Prevalent Ethnicity by School in 2023-24 School Year
School name Most prevalent ethnicity % of Total Student Population Total Enrollment
Philadelphia High School Black 90.5% 338
Neshoba Central Middle School White 60.4% 667
Philadelphia Elementary School Black 81.9% 431
Neshoba Central High School White 57.2% 956
Neshoba Central Elementary School White 64.4% 1,466
